Why did Ben allow the Losties to leave the island in S4?
I saw a recap show last night (actually narrated by Ben!) and I was a bit confused after seeing Ben freely allowing the Losties (Katie, Sawyer et al) to leave the island via helicopter in S4, when he had spent most of the entire series trying to keep them on the island. I haven't re-watched the previous seasons in-depth so it may be an obvious answer!! I was just curious last night when I saw Ben cutting the rope on Kate's wrists and telling them they were free leave by taking the chopper... was their job done?? Or did it not matter because he was going to move the island and knew he would have to go and persuade them to return afterwards. Island protection first, then took a gamble that he could bring them back?

Re: Why did Ben allow the Losties to leave the island in S4?
Ben did not make that decision. It was Richard who made the decision. Ben asks him "What was the arrangement" once he has been released from Keemy.
However I think him agreeing to Richards decision of letting Sayid and Kate go was similar to when he let Michael go on the boat. He knew Michael would come back as the Island was not done with him. He knew that he would leave the Island and he knows that regardless of what it takes to get them back, they will come back.
